With 13 weeks at the top of the Billboard Argentina Hot 100, Karol G and Nicki Minaj's "Tusa" matches the record set by Sech and Darrell's "Otro Trago" in 2019. "Tusa" started as a summer hit that has now continued into the middle of autumn.
Following at No. 2 is Bad Bunny with "Yo Perreo Sola." The song is one of six from his latest album, YHLQMDLG, currently on the chart, with the Puerto Rican boasting nine songs total on the list.

Miky Woodz achieves his second top 10 on the Top Latin Albums chart, as Los 90 Piketes debuts at No. 10 on the May 2 survey. Woodz’s third studio album bows with 4,000 equivalent album units earned in the week ending April 23, according to Nielsen Music/MRC Data, most of which are attributed to streaming activity.

Beloved Argentine actor, composer, writer, illustrator and musician Horacio "El Negro" Fontova -- who carved a career on the stage and the television screen -- has died after a long battle with cancer. He was 73 years old.
